Key cost

Things are getting more expensive all the time, from the latest smartphones to the latest home. Some of the most expensive things such as car keys, have the same cost. They're also difficult to replace. It's not hard to understand why. The security measures used by car manufacturers are becoming more advanced as technology improves and it costs more to duplicate or replace them.

The cost can vary significantly depending on the type of key you have and the make of your vehicle. For instance the mechanical key used for older models is cheap to replace and easy to duplicate, while an electronic key that opens the doors of your vehicle and starts the engine at the touch of a the button is significantly more expensive. The key's electronic features and number of features are also aspects that impact the price.

The cost of transponder chips

There are several variables which determine the cost of the new car key. The first is that it is based on the year, model and model of the vehicle. Transponder chips can be found in a variety of keys on modern automobiles. These need to be paired up with the computer of the vehicle. If the chip is not matched correctly, the engine will not start. This process is typically performed by an auto locksmith or dealer.

Another factor is the type of key you own. If you own switchesblade keys for instance it will cost more expensive than a standard key. This is due to the fact that switchesblade keys are spring loaded and fold into a fob that looks like the regular key. In addition there are security codes working within these keys that require to be programmed.

The cost of a new key also depends on the place you get it from. Locksmiths and hardware stores usually cost less than dealerships. They're not always well-equipped for the job. Some of these businesses do not have the equipment needed to program and cut the car key. You should, therefore, only employ a certified company.
